NOTE2: Further edited for clarification based on feedback. As the dual problem has lesser number of constraints than the primal (2 instead of 4), it requires lesser work and effort to solve it. to the algorithm is a model in dual form, primal cone constraints can be detected. 1. Linear programming Primal to dual conversion (Max -> min) question. It is the same problem solved with the primal simplex algorithm. Install Parser.py and PrimalToDual.py; Write the file name to be converted in the same directory (Example: "Primal.txt") To illustrate the procedure you need to follow, consider the problem: Primal Linear Program. A fourth variant of the same equations leads to a new primal-dual method. a If the primal LP is unbounded (i.e., optimal cost = 1), then the dual LP is infeasible. PRIMAL & DUAL PROBLEMS OPERATION RESEARCH Submitted by : Khambhayata Mayur (130010119042) Khant Vijaykumar (130010119045) Lad Yashkumar (130010119047) Submitted to : 2. The primal-dual method is a standard tool in the de-sign of algorithms for combinatorial optimizationproblems. We use the last tableau of the previous iteration adding there the values of the x 2-column obtained from knowing B 1: x 1 x 2 xr 1 x r 2 x r 3 y 0 = ˘ 3 0 14 0 4 0 xr 1 1 0 6 1 1 0 x 1 1=3 1 2=3 0 1=3 0 xr 3 2 0 8 0 2 1 Here, the second column was obtained using the formulas ce 2 = c 2 (1; 3;1) 0 What is the primal-dual method? 3 The dual of the dual is the primal The following result establishes the dual relation between the primal and the dual. 2 Primal-dual methods for linear programming in which the iterates lie in the strict interior of the feasible region. Learn more Support us (New) All problem can be solved using search box: b . However since g( ) is concave and L1: 1.0 x 1 + 1.0 x 2 + 1.0 x 3 <= 85. Theorem 5.1 (The Weak Duality Theorem). + cnxn subject to . Theorem: The dual of the dual is the primal. For instance MATLAB can solve using the linprog command as it is documented. This follows from the fact that the computational difficulty in the linear programming problem is . Hi, I am trying to convert a primal LP problem into it's corresponding dual. This video will help you to understand the Rules for Converting the Primal into Dual in easy way. (Recap of primal to dual conversion) Solver selections-Dual, Image Source: (Image from Author) The optimal solution for Dual LPP, Example-1, Image Source: (Image from Author) We notice the value of the objective function value of primal (maximization) and the dual (minimization) remains the same. The dual or primal can be solved using any method that is suitable( simplex method, two phase method, etc.). View License. Description. Let the primal problem be Max Z x = c 1x 1 + c 2x 2 + … +c nx n Subject to restrictions a 11x 1 + a 12x 2 . Notice that if you run Algorithms B,C,D in sequence, then you get another algorithm for converting a primal canonical to a dual canonical. The main contributions made here are: (i) a computationally useful interpretation of the Lagrange multipliers associated with the dual orthogonality . The examples solved in this video are of different cases wh. First we will prove our earlier assertion that the optimal solution of a dual program gives a bound on the optimal value of the primal program. my teacher said that it's incorrect and i dont know how it's incorrect. Lec-9 Primal Dual. Primal Linear Program. by analyzing C and A in a constraint C − A T ( y) ∈ K. LP and SOCP cones are. I am having trouble searching in the documentation and I just wanted to be clear. version 1.0.0 (7.75 KB) by Erdem Altuntac. PRIMAL-DUAL CONVERSION (5 points each) 3. This repository extends LP_Parser functionallity with an additional feature of converting a primal problem to dual problem. Content Duality in Linear Programming Problems Different useful aspects Points to remember while converting into dual Conversion of primal to its dual Important modification . However, the optimal solution isn't g = 0, but rather g = − 6 at ( w 1, w 2) = ( 0, − 3 5). This video explains steps for primal to dual problem conversion...For more queries :Email :- sandeepkgo. This video explains concept of duality and steps for primal to dual problem conversion...For more queri. Suppose the primal is Maximize Z = cTx such that Ax ≤ b, x ≥ 0. You can specify up to 6 variables and 10 constraints in the primal problem, with any mixture of <=, >=, and = constraints. PRIMAL DUAL. 5 I obtained a non-zero solution for the primal model but as for the dual model I obtained a dual optimal solution of zero instead. View primal to dual conversion.pdf from EGRMGMT 264 at Duke University. We also automatically download the COSEG and Human Body datasets, which we preprocessed from the . 4 Overview of the primal dual approach Now, we will look at one of the approaches to solve the linear program for maximum ow (that will solve the min cut problem too). Proof. It is a one-one mapping where a point maps to a line and a line maps to a point. The practical steps involved in formulating dual problem from the primal problem are as follows: Step 1→ Ensure that in case of a maximization problem all constraints are of '≤' type or in case of a minimization problem, all constraints are of '≥' type.If not, adopt the following procedure: Primal-Dual: First Steps Primal-Dual: Hitting Sets Primal-Dual: Steiner Trees Primal Dual: MCF Jochen Könemann, September 25, 2004 Group Strategyproof Mechanisms for Steiner Forests - p. 2/44 What is the primal-dual method? By browsing this website, you agree to our use of cookies. TEOREMA DE HOLGURAS COMPLEMENTARIAS:Una variable en el primal esta asociada a una restricción en el dual (y viceversa). Lec-9 Primal Dual. Conversion of primal into its dual. At optimality, x 1 and x 2 are nonzero, so by complementary slackness, the corresponding constraints in the dual are binding. Simplex Method 2_Primal Simplex to Dual Simplex Problem Conversion. Solution provided by AtoZmath.com. 6 w 1 + 5 w 2 ≤ − 3. Scanned with CamScanner Scanned with CamScanner Scanned with CamScanner Scanned with CamScanner Scanned with 25 2000 . Maximize Z = X1 - X2 + 3X3. Si el primal tiene m restricciones y n variables, el dual tendrá n restricciones y m variables. The minimi-sation of L(x; ) over xmight be hard. MATLAB and . 4. Alternativamente si el problema primal es infactible, entonces el dual es no acotado. How to run. We concentrate on re-sults from recent research applying the primal-dual method The linear program you give as the dual is correct. 4. 4 upper shock mounts, with lock nuts and washers. Los signos de desigualdad del problema dual son contrarios a los del primal. The following example will be solved using the dual simplex algorithm (Restrepo, Linear Programming, 83-90), to illustrate this technique. How to Use the Scale Conversion Calculator. ()), i.e., the inequality constraints of both the primal and dual problems should be either greater or smaller than zero L1: 1.0 x 1 + 1.0 x 2 + 1.0 x 3 <= 85. ⏩Comment Below If This Video Helped You Like & Share With Your Classmates - ALL THE BEST Do Visit My Second Channel - https://bit.ly/3rMGcSAThis vi. We use cookies to improve your experience on our site and to show you relevant advertising. The aim of this paper is not to derive new results, but rather to provide insight that will hopefully aid researchers involved in the design and coding of algorithms for geometric programs. The idea behind the primal dual paradigm arises from the fact that we may relax the primal and dual slackness conditions in order to get approximation algorithms (instead of optimal algorithms). This is the dual problem of the original primal problem. TEORÍA DE LA EMPRESA El conjunto de posibilidades de producción: Las empresas poseen tecnología la cual les permite transformar ciertos factores productivos (inputs) en sus productos finales (outputs) los que luego son ofrecidos al público. Does gurobi have anything which helps in the conversion of primal and dual? Suppose we have a set of feasible solutions (~x;~z) for which relaxed dual slackness conditions hold, as follows: Dual Complementary Slackness zj >0 =) X i CONVERSION DE DUAL A PRIMAL uwerduran. Duality is an extremely important feature of linear programming. Primal to dual conversion Rules & Example-1 online. It's a simple online calculator which only requires a few values for it to perform the calculation instantaneously. THE REDDY MIKKS COMPANY- PROBLEM Reddy. For every variable in the primal, there is a constraint in the dual. Corollary 4.4. Write the dual of the following LP problem. (0) 208 Downloads. Solve the Linear programming problem using Primal to dual conversion calculator. 1. The various useful aspects of this property are: 1. . Dual Problem Primal LP : Max z = c1x1 + c2x2 + . 3. Gurobi currently does not offer a tool to write the dual problem. 1. Examine the tableaux that follow to see how the dual simplex method proceeds to find the solution. Primal-Dual Algorithm. I recommend having a look at the most recent developments around JuMP.They have developed two interesting packages this year: MathOptFormat.jl, that allows to import/export optimization problem in MPS, LP, CBF, etc. School of Organization and Management, Yale University, USA . There is example code below showing the input of the primal. c TT Hereafter, we call () the dual conversion of \(\nabla u\) on S.For example, the dual conversion of \(\nabla u\) on \({\varOmega }\) produces ().By choosing S as appropriately defined subdomain interfaces, the primal-dual algorithm for () becomes to have a natural parallel structure.We note that a similar decoupling strategy for block coordinate descent methods was introduced in []. The main contributions made here are: (i) a computationally useful interpretation of the Lagrange multipliers associated with the dual orthogonality constraints, (ii) a computationally useful interpretation . This chapter shows how the primal-dual method can be modified to provide good approximation algorithms for a wide variety of NP-hard problems. This section introduces a number of primal-dual relationships that can be used to recompute the elements of the optimal simplex tableau. PRIMAL TO DUAL CONVERSION RULE. Rules for converting Primal to Dual If the Primal is to maximize, the dual is to minimize. b If the dual LP is unbounded (i.e., optimal cost = 1), then the primal LP is infeasible. Examine the tableaux that follow to see how the dual simplex method proceeds to find the solution. The optimal solution of either problem reveals the information about the optimal solution of the other. 2 Primal-dual methods for linear programming in which the iterates lie in the strict interior of the feasible region. Learn more Support us (New) All problem can be solved using search box: . ×. Equality constraint in the primal, resulting in a variable unrestricted in sign in the dual. The aim of this paper is not to derive new results, but rather to provide insight that will hopefully aid researchers involved in the design and coding of algorithms for geometric programs. Originally proposed by Dantzig, Ford, and Fulkerson in 1956 Primal-dual transformation. 2. NOTE: I edited my question from asking for the dual to asking for the dual results (based on feedback). Linear programming Primal to dual conversion (Max -> min) question. Let P= max(c>xjAx b;x 0;x2R n), - called the Lagrange dual problem, associated with the primal problem - finds best lower bound on p⇤, obtained from Lagrange dual function - a convex optimization problem; optimal value denoted by d⇤ - , ⌫ are said to be dual feasible if ⌫ 0 and (, ⌫) 2 dom g - often simplified by making implicit constraints (, ⌫) 2 dom g explicit xL(x; ) is known as the dual function. main paper). The code provided automatically downloads the datasets SHREC and Cube Engraving in the downsampled version provided by MeshCNN. Consider the following set of constraints . The following table provides the basic data of the problem: Tons of raw material per ton of Exterior paint Interior paint Maximum daily availability (tons) 24 6. Since g( ) is a pointwise minimum of a ne functions (L(x; ) is a ne, i.e. Scanned with CamScanner Scanned with CamScanner Scanned with CamScanner Scanned with CamScanner Scanned with 4 lower shock mounting bolts with lock nuts. Dual to primal conversion in geometric programming. a) If one of the two problems have finite optimal solution, the other also does. Maximize Z = x1 - x2 + 3x3 subject to the constraints x1 + x2 + x3 ≤ 10 2x1 - x2 - x3 ≤ 2 2x1 - 2x2 - 3x3 ≤ 6 and x1, x2, x3 ≥ 0 2. my teacher said that it's incorrect and i dont know how it's incorrect. It follows that ( y 2, y 3) is an optimal basis for the dual, with y 2 ⋆ = 0, y 3 ⋆ = 1 3 . By browsing this website, you agree to our use of cookies. Primal-dual algorithm involving proximity operator for Bregman iterated variational regularization. Consider a primal-dual pair of linear programs as above. Dual simplex method is a completeopposite of the conditions in the normal simplex method. 3. The dual simplex algorithm calculates a sequence of tableaux. Note that which of the two inequalities of the dual problem is used depends on which of the two inequalities of the primal problem is used, as indicated in Table 157.Specifically, for this minimization primal problem, (Eq. Algorithm C: Convert a primal standard to a dual standard. Dualitytheorem notation • p⋆ is the primal optimal value; d⋆ is the dual optimal value • p⋆ =+∞ if primal problem is infeasible; d⋆ =−∞ if dual is infeasible • p⋆ =−∞ if primal problem is unbounded; d⋆ =∞ if dual is unbounded dualitytheorem: if primal or dual problem is feasible, then p⋆ =d⋆ moreover, if p⋆ =d⋆ is finite, then primal and dual optima are . The conjugate of the indicator of the cone {x: x 0} is the indicator of the polar cone {x . Write the dual to the following LP problem. As we will see later, this will always be the case since ''the dual of the dual is the primal.'' This is an important result since it implies that the dual may be solved instead of the primal whenever there are computational advantages.

Quartieri Dove Vivere A Zurigo, Schlehenlikör Nach Omas Rezept, Hyperbare Sauerstofftherapie Verjüngung, Polystyrene Dust Inhalation, Ashwagandha Ayurveda Wirkung, Torische Kontaktlinsen Farbig, Como Desactivar Las Notificaciones En Los Airpods, Maison à Vendre Port Des Monards, Amc Schnellkochtopf Deckel Altes Modell, Zierquitte Ausläufer Entfernen, افرازات مخاطية في الشهر الخامس, Vielen Dank Für Ihre Bemühungen, أحكام تجويد سورة القصص,

Share This

primal to dual conversion

Share this post with your friends!